God does have expectations for us regarding Worship.

God wants our whole being to Worship Him. We have learned in church that we must do everything for and to the Lord. We have experienced renewed minds as we consciously remember to Worship Him in our day. This is good. But have we surrendered all we can?

Put your heart and soul into every activity you do, as though you are doing it for the Lord himself and not merely for others.  For we know that we will receive a reward, an inheritance from the Lord, as we serve the Lord Yahweh, the Anointed One!” — Colossians 3:23-24 (TPT)

The beauty of this verse and what it really means is knowing that we will receive a reward from Jesus. Personally, I can forget that.

I can easily fall into the trap of only remembering verse 23.
